The France Cold Storage Market is experiencing significant growth as the demand for temperature-controlled logistics continues to rise across the food and beverage, pharmaceutical, healthcare, and e-commerce industries. France is one of Europe's leading food producers and exporters, making cold storage infrastructure essential for preserving product quality, reducing food waste, and ensuring regulatory compliance. Increasing consumption of frozen foods, fresh produce, dairy products, seafood, and temperature-sensitive pharmaceuticals is driving investments in modern cold storage facilities throughout the country.

Cold storage facilities are designed to maintain precise temperature conditions for storing perishable goods throughout the supply chain. These warehouses utilize advanced refrigeration systems, automated handling equipment, and digital monitoring technologies to ensure product safety while improving operational efficiency. As France strengthens its food supply chain and pharmaceutical distribution network, the need for reliable cold storage solutions continues to expand.

Growing Demand for Frozen and Processed Foods

French consumers are increasingly purchasing frozen and ready-to-eat food products due to changing lifestyles and greater convenience.

Major products requiring cold storage include:

  • Frozen vegetables
  • Meat and poultry
  • Seafood
  • Dairy products
  • Ready-to-cook meals
  • Ice cream

Growing food consumption is encouraging retailers and logistics providers to expand refrigerated warehouse capacity.

Pharmaceutical Cold Chain Creating New Opportunities

The healthcare sector is becoming an important driver of market growth.

Temperature-controlled storage is essential for:

  • Vaccines
  • Biopharmaceuticals
  • Insulin
  • Blood products
  • Clinical trial materials

The growing pharmaceutical industry continues to increase demand for specialized refrigerated warehouses.


Technological Advancements Improving Warehouse Operations

Cold storage operators are investing in advanced technologies to improve efficiency and product safety.

Important innovations include:

  • Automated storage systems
  • Internet of Things (IoT) sensors
  • Artificial intelligence for inventory management
  • Real-time temperature monitoring
  • Energy-efficient refrigeration equipment

These technologies reduce operating costs while ensuring strict temperature compliance.

Sustainability Initiatives Improving Energy Efficiency

Warehouse operators are implementing environmentally friendly technologies to reduce energy consumption.

Key initiatives include:

  • Natural refrigerants
  • Solar energy systems
  • Energy-efficient compressors
  • Smart building management
  • Carbon emission reduction programs

These investments improve operational sustainability while reducing long-term costs.


Challenges Facing the Market

Despite strong growth prospects, several challenges remain.

High Energy Costs

Refrigerated warehouses require continuous electricity for cooling operations.

Infrastructure Investment

Building modern cold storage facilities requires substantial capital investment.

Regulatory Compliance

Strict food safety and pharmaceutical regulations require continuous monitoring.

Skilled Workforce Shortages

Operating automated refrigerated facilities requires specialized technical expertise.
